Top 5 Panda Games on iOS in Bulgaria for Q1 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 Panda-themed games on iOS in Bulgaria during Q1 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
The first quarter of 2023 saw varied performances for the top 5 Panda-themed games on iOS in Bulgaria. Here’s a detailed look at the tr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users, with data sourced from Sensor Tower.
Bubble Shooter - Panda Pop!
Bubble Shooter - Panda Pop! from Jam City, Inc. had f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$36 in mid-January before gradually decreasing to around $14-$25 towards the end of March. Weekly downloads were minimal, with a notable peak of 9 in mid-January. The game had a significant drop in active users from 31 in mid-January to around 11 by late March.
Baby Panda World - BabyBus
Baby Panda World by BABYBUS experienced a mixed revenue performance, with a notable spike to $43 in early March. Weekly downloads were relatively low, with minor peaks of 11 in early January and occasional downloads throughout the quarter. There was no significant data on active users for most of the quarter.
Taichi Panda: Heroes
Taichi Panda: Heroes by Snail Games USA Inc. showed a consistent but low revenue trend, with a notable increase to $18 in the last week of March. The game had no significant weekly downloads throughout the quarter, and there was no available data on active users.
Dr. Panda Town Tales: New Life
Dr. Panda Town Tales: New Life from Dr. Panda Ltd had a relatively stable revenue stream, with occasional spikes, peaking at $5 in mid-January and mid-March. Weekly downloads were highest at the start of the year, with 39 in early January, but saw a decline towards the end of the quarter. Active users also saw a decline from 85 in early January to 66 by late March.
Dr. Panda Restaurant 3
Dr. Panda Restaurant 3 from Dr. Panda Ltd had minimal revenue throughout the quarter, with a brief increase to $21 in mid-January. Weekly downloads showed some variability, peaking at 35 at the end of January. Active users fluctuated, starting at 42 in early January, dropping to 13 in late January, and experiencing intermittent activity through February and March.
